Understanding the Filler Neck and Cap: A Key Component of Your Fuel System | |
When it comes to maintaining your vehicle’s fuel system, the filler neck and cap play a critical role in both functionality and safety. The filler neck is the connecting piece between the fuel tank and the fuel cap, guiding fuel efficiently into the tank during refueling. While it may seem like a simple part, the design and material of the filler neck have a direct impact on the longevity and performance of your fuel system. Filler necks are typically made from either metal or reinforced rubber. Metal fuel filler necks are commonly constructed from materials such as aluminum, steel, or chrome-plated steel. These metals offer strength and durability, especially when exposed to varying weather conditions and road environments. In recent years, powder-coated filler necks have gained popularity due to their enhanced resistance to rust, corrosion, and wear. This protective coating ensures the neck remains functional and visually intact over extended periods. The fuel cap—often overlooked—serves as a seal that prevents fuel vapors from escaping and shields the tank from dirt, debris, and moisture. Modern caps are built with advanced sealing technology to ensure emissions compliance and to help maintain pressure within the tank. A worn-out or damaged cap can lead to fuel evaporation, poor gas mileage, and even check engine warnings. Despite their durability, filler necks and caps can be affected by prolonged exposure to harsh chemicals, road salt, and environmental conditions. Over time, this may lead to corrosion, rust, or cracking, which can compromise fuel efficiency and vehicle safety. Regular inspections and timely replacements of your filler neck and cap can prevent fuel leaks and improve overall performance.
